Here is my implementation of double linked list. Is it possible to reduce the code and improve it?
Some methods here:
- head (returns head of the list) tail (returns tail of the list);
- append (param: new data; add new item to the end of the list);
- deleteAt (param: index; deletes item by index; error handling)
- at(returns item by index; error handling)
- insertAt (inserts item by index; new item should be placed at the specified index)
- reverse (rearranges the list's items back-to-front)
- each (param: function; applies specified function to each item of the list)
- indexOF(param: item; return index of the specified item (first entry))
function List() {
this.length = 0;
this._head = null;
this._tail = null;
}
List.prototype = {
head: function() {
if (this.length > 0) {
return this._head;
} else {
throw new Error("List has zero length.");
}
},
tail: function() {
if (this.length > 0) {
return this._tail;
} else {
throw new Error("List has zero length.");
}
},
append: function(value) {
var node = {
value: value,
next: null,
prev: null,
}
if (this.length == 0) {
this._head = node;
this._tail = node;
} else {
this._tail.next = node;
node.prev = this._tail;
this._tail = node;
}
this.length++;
return this;
},
deleteAt: function(index) {
if (index < this.length) {
var node = this._head;
var i = 0;
while (i < index) {
node = node.next;
i++;
}
while (i != this.length - 1) {
node.value = node.next.value;
this._tail = node;
node = node.next;
i++;
}
node.value = null;
node.next = null;
this.length--;
return this;
} else {
throw new Error("The index of the item that you have selected more than the length of the list.");
}
},
at: function (index) {
return this._at(index).value;
},
_at: function(index) {
if (this.length < index) {
throw new Error("The index of the item that you have selected more than the length of the list.");
} else {
var node = this._head;
var i = 0;
while (i != index) {
node = node.next;
i++;
}
return node;
}
},
insertAt: function(index, value) {
if (index < this.length) {
var node = {
value: value,
next: null,
prev: null,
}
var nodeCur = this._at(index);
var nodePrev = nodeCur.prev;
var nodeNext = nodeCur.next;
node.prev = nodePrev;
node.next = nodeNext;
nodePrev.next = node;
nodeNext.prev = node;
this.length++;
return this;
} else {
throw new Error("The index of the item that you have selected more than the length of the list.");
}
},
reverse: function() {
var node_buf = {
value: null,
next: null,
prev: null,
}
var node_head = this._head;
var node_tail = this._tail;
var i = 0;
while (i < Math.floor(this.length / 2)) {
node_buf.value = node_tail.value;
node_tail.value = node_head.value;
node_head.value = node_buf.value;
node_head = node_head.next;
node_tail = node_tail.prev;
i++;
}
return this;
},
each: function(callback) {
var node = this._head;
var i = 0;
while (i < this.length) {
node.value = callback(node.value);
i++;
node = node.next;
}
return this;
},
indexOF: function(value) {
var node = this._head;
var i = 0;
while (i != this.length) {
if (node.value == value) {
return i;
}
node = node.next;
i++;
}
throw new Error("Value " + value + " is not found.");
}
};
